These two tractors are very similar in construction, reflecting the closely-connected history of the two companies. Their engines are interchangeable, and either two-wheel tractor can drive all common implement types and sizes. The Grillo G110 is brand new, and has the active clutch lever now standard on all European brands. The BCS 850 has the old-fashioned passive clutch lever, which can be tiring for small hands. It is maybe 20 years old, but if properly maintained these machine don’t lose much with age. The BCS includes one implement: a rototiller or rotary plow.
